Andover Central is 0-5 against Maize South since April of 2016 but things could change on Friday. The Jaguars will welcome the Mavericks. The two teams have allowed few runs on average (Andover Central 3.6, Maize South 0.2) so any runs scored will be well earned.

Andover Central made up a huge gap compared to their last game against Seaman, but they still couldn't quite topple them. The Jaguars fell just short of the Vikings by a score of 4-2 on Friday. That's two games in a row now that the Jaguars have lost by exactly two runs.

Meanwhile, Maize South strolled into their game on Thursday with a perfect record and they left with the same. They never let Great Bend get on the board and left with an 11-0 win. Fans of the Mavericks have seen this all before: every one of the games they've played this season has ended in a blowout of 6+ runs.

Sophie Stockam made a splash while hitting and pitching. On the mound, she didn't allow a single earned run and allowed only two hits while striking out 18 over seven innings pitched. Stockam was also big at the plate, going 3-for-5 with three RBI and one double.

In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Kiley Thornquist, who got on base in all five of her plate appearances with two stolen bases, two runs, and two RBI. Lizzy Lassley was another key player, getting on base in four of her five plate appearances with three runs, one stolen base, and one double.

Maize South always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.548.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Great Bend only posted an OBP of .087.

Maize South's victory bumped their record up to 4-0. As for Andover Central, they now have a losing record of 2-3.
